About This Item

Berlin, Germany: Presse- und informationsamt des Landes Berlin, 1969. 19 x 20 cm. Cover features color photo of President Nixon standing in open limousine in motorcade through Berlin, while Berliners wave. Introduction to text by B�rgermeister Klaus Sch�tz. Photos of arrival, visits to Charlottenburg Palace and Siemens Factory, photos of departure. Statement by Nixon, upon return to Washington: ""If you could have been with me as rode through the streets of Berlin on a snowy cold day and have seen the hopeful faces in those crowds on the streets....you (the American people) would have been proud that America did meet her world responsibilities in helping others defend their freedom."" Paper booklet, very good. . Catalogs: Cold War/History.
